    Sassuolo has had a mediocre performance this season in Serie A. They've secured 1 win, 1 draw, and 1 loss in 3 league games. After a draw with Bologna, they've remained undefeated in the last 2 league games and even in 3 consecutive matches across all competitions. Their overall form has been relatively stable. However, the team is currently facing a severe injury crisis. Center - back Farid, defensive midfielder Polka, central midfielder Koné, attacking midfielder Volpato, left - back Piellati, and attacking midfielder Bacola are all out due to injuries. This has led to significant losses in multiple positions, and the depth for rotation in both attack and defense has clearly decreased. Although playing at home will get the support of their fans, such a large number of injuries will greatly undermine the team's competitiveness. As for Juventus, they will surely look to capitalize on Sassuolo's injury - hit situation and aim for a win in this encounter.

      Sassuolo has shown a mixed performance at the start of the new Serie A season. With 1 win, 1 draw, and 1 loss in the first three rounds, they've accumulated 4 points and currently sit at 11th in the league standings. The team plays an open - style game, with balanced offensive and defensive statistics. In the three matches, they've scored 5 goals but also conceded 5. This indicates a lack of defensive stability, as they often have defensive lapses. On the other hand, Juventus has had a steady start. They've remained unbeaten in the first three rounds, winning 2 and drawing 1, to collect 7 points and secure the 5th position on the table. Juventus is well - known for its solid defense. They've conceded only 1 goal in three games, with a well - organized back - line and excellent control of defensive errors. Sassuolo shows good combat power at home.       Sassuolo has shown a mediocre performance so far this season. After three rounds, they have one win, one draw, and one loss, accumulating four points and sitting in the 11th position. The team has a distinct pattern: decent at home, inconsistent away, and an imbalance between attack and defense. In their season - opener at home, they impressed by defeating Torino 2 - 1. On the other hand, Juventus has had a steady start. With two wins and one draw in three league matches, the team has seven points and ranks fifth. They are one of the best - defended teams in Serie A this season. Their defense is rock - solid, conceding only one goal in three rounds, which is the best in the league.
